On Marketting
Oct. 23rd, 2017 12:49 pmFor her fifth birthday, my daughter got a set of My Little Pony - The Movie bedsheets. (She got a lot of MLP stuff, mostly because it's the only thing we're sure she likes; most things she claims to enjoy because her brother does, but actually gets bored and wanders away very quickly.) The duvet cover is festooned with ponies - Twilight Sparkle, Rainbow Dash, Fluttershy, Rarity, Pinkie Pie.
Some of you may have noticed the weirdness here. Yeah, aren't there six main ponies?
For some reason, Applejack hasn't made it onto the bedclothes. It's not like there wasn't space - there's dozens of the five ponies all over them. But no Applejack. Which is... weird?
My theory is that because her stereotypical personality is so specifically American (unlike 'posh and likes clothes' or 'shy and likes animals'), kids in the UK don't tend to be a fan, so they've cut her out. But it still seems pretty odd. Maybe she dies in the movie? [Ducks] I kid, I kid...

Inducing geekery
Sep. 12th, 2017 02:37 pmThe first proper fandom moment my children had came sometime this spring, when the TV told them that Numberblocks (a show teaching them to count and do basic arithmetic) would be introducing five NEW characters ('six' to 'ten', since I know you're dying to find out). They were incredibly excited - so much so that we shuffled that weekend around so that they could be in front of the TV to watch the first episodes for 6 (Saturday) and 7 (Sunday).
I think that counts as a success.
